iShares FTSE China 50 Index ETF (02801.HK) Fell 0.79%, with the Latest Price at HKD 24.980
Newtimespace News: As of 10:35 on May 20, the iShares FTSE China 50 Index ETF (02801.HK) fell 0.79%, with the latest price at HKD 24.980, a high of HKD 25.280, a low of HKD 24.980, an average price of HKD 25.028, assets under management of approximately HKD 15.67 billion, a latest net asset value of HKD 25.225, and a discount of 0.18%.
The iShares FTSE China 50 Index ETF (02801.HK) tracks the FTSE China 50 Index, which consists of the 50 largest Chinese stocks by market capitalization listed on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ange, covering sectors such as finance, technology, consumer goods, and communication services, reflecting the overall performance of the offshore Chinese equity market.
